Adeleke Sanni

 

The immediate past President of Nigerian Port Authority (NPA) branch of Maritime Workers Union of Nigeria (MWUN) and a former Vice Chairman of Lagos State Council of Nigeria Labour Congress (NLC) Adeleke Sanni, is dead.

He died on Sunday in Lagos.

President-General of MWUN, Comrade Adewale Adeyanju, who confirmed his death, said Sanni was on his way to a church service when he suddenly slumped and died few minutes later before he could get to a hospital.

The late Sanni, who was until his death the Special Adviser to Prince Adeyanju, last Wednesday attended the Shipping, Clearing and Forwarding Agencies 5th Quadrennial Delegates Conference Branch elections in Lagos.

“The wife confirmed to me that they were on their way to the church and he wanted to withdraw money from the ATM.

“On his way back to the car, he just slumped and before they could get to the hospital he gave up the ghost.

“He was with us on Thursday and he attended the stakeholders’ security meeting organised by NPA at KLT.

“There was no complaint of any ailment from him. His death is unfortunate and a great loss to the union. Comrade Sanni was a unionist to the core who contributed greatly to the success of the union.

“Sanni was very dear to me; a great man that carried out his assignment with diligence.

“He was one of the best advisers I have in the union. I will personally miss him because we had been together for more than 20 years,” Adeyanju said.
